The Guide
The Guide is a discontinued, portable desktop application designed for creating and organizing information in a hierarchical tree structure. It functions as an outliner and a basic personal information manager, allowing users to associate text and notes with each node in the tree. by Mahadevan R

OpenNote
OpenNote is a free and open-source web-based note-taking application designed as an alternative to commercial offerings like OneNote and Evernote. It focuses on providing a lightweight yet feature-rich environment for organizing your thoughts and information.
